Description Lars Vogel CLA 2018-09-16 07:36:57 EDT
Created attachment 275836 [details]
Templates screenshot

We should offer templates to make it easier to add e4 menu entries and e4 toolbar entries to the IDE.

See screenshot.

Comment 4 Olivier Prouvost CLA 2018-09-16 09:12:35 EDT
But it is already done if you do :

New Plugin Project
Make Contribution to UI
And select the template... 

Something better would be to definitively say : 
  
   Make Contribution to UI -> E3 or E4. 

In E4 we could select JFace or Java FX and that should depend on the good library, and in E3 it would depend on org.eclipse.ui...

Comment 6 Lars Vogel CLA 2018-09-16 09:43:12 EDT
Created attachment 275837 [details]
3.x command

Yes, but if you have already a project you cannot easily add a new e4 menu entry to it. It is available for the e3 command, see new screenshot. Always creating a new project is not the best way, if you have already the plug-in.
